Abstract

The invention relates to a motor front cover structure of an embedded dust collector. The motor front cover structure comprises a front cover main body, wherein the front cover main body comprises a connecting pipe body and a fan blade cover which are of an integrated structure; the connecting pipe body is of a cylindrical tubular structure; the front end of the connecting pipe body is provided with a pipe end part which is inwards contracted towards the center; the pipe end part is connected with the fan blade cover; an inserted link which is axially arranged is connected to the outer wall of the connecting pipe body; a slot is formed in the inserted link; the fan blade cover is integrally provided with a funnel-shaped structure; the section of the fan blade cover is of a rectangular structure; two ends of the fan blade cover are respectively connected with a mounting casing and a mounting lug cover; the end part of the mounting casing is provided with a wire and cable slot. When the motor front cover structure of the embedded dust collector is mounted, the inserted link, an inserted plate and a motor rear cover are connected, the mounting casing and the mounting lug cover are connected with an enclosure, the mounting operation is simple, and the efficiency is high; the width of the short edge of the rectangular section of the fan blade cover is smaller than the external diameter of the connecting pipe body, the fan blade cover adopts the funnel structure, the suction of dust on fan blades is facilitated, and the suction efficiency is high.
